The tennis world has been set abuzz after Novak Djokovic delivered striking comments about Jannik Sinner, describing the Italian star as one of the closest reflections of his own mentality on the court. The remarks quickly went viral and reignited discussions about the future of men’s tennis.

Djokovic, widely regarded as one of the greatest players in tennis history, emphasized that he sees in Sinner a rare combination of discipline, emotional control, and relentless ambition. His words highlighted not only admiration but also recognition of a rising force shaping the next generation.

The Serbian champion reportedly stated that he does not often see his own competitive mindset reflected in other players. However, in Sinner, he identified qualities that mirror the intensity and focus he has developed throughout his own legendary career at the top level.

One of the key aspects Djokovic highlighted was Sinner’s composure under pressure. In modern tennis, where matches can shift in a matter of minutes, the ability to remain calm and execute under stress is considered one of the most valuable traits a player can possess.

Sinner’s rise in recent years has been marked by consistency and rapid development. His powerful baseline game, combined with an increasingly refined tactical understanding, has allowed him to compete successfully against the sport’s most established names on the biggest stages.

Djokovic also praised Sinner’s ability to strike the ball at an elite level, noting that his clean and aggressive style of play makes him a constant threat to any opponent. This technical precision has become one of the defining features of his game.

Beyond physical skill, the Serbian legend emphasized Sinner’s hunger for victory. According to Djokovic, it is this internal drive that separates good players from truly exceptional ones, and Sinner’s determination places him firmly in the latter category.
